Transaction cadd873bb553edff6376ad633c567ec537f1971090e0b5518d7b267527538bf6
1 Input
1 Output
-
cadd873bb553edff6376ad633c567ec537f1971090e0b5518d7b267527538bf6:0
- value
- 335387
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cfa99f260145e6e7c40a2553b711a02eb48db34 OP_EQUAL
- address
- 3MqSnqKDdcZAJajf3nAXzxPsUavUTyG4hy